Obtaining a vendor's license in Ohio is a crucial step for individuals and businesses looking to engage in taxable sales within the state. The Ohio Application for Vendor's License form serves as the official document required for this process. It requires applicants to provide essential information, including their ownership type—be it a sole proprietorship, partnership, corporation, or other business structures. Applicants must also indicate when they plan to begin their sales activities and specify if they will operate from a temporary location without a fixed place of business. Additionally, the form asks for the North American Industry Classification System (NAICS) code to categorize the nature of the business. Legal names, trade names, and contact details are also necessary, along with an estimate of expected monthly sales tax collections. For corporations and partnerships, it is important to list the names and identification numbers of key individuals involved. The application process concludes with a signature and a $25 fee, which is payable to the Ohio Treasurer of State. Federal Privacy Act Notice
Because we require you to provide us with a Social Security number, the Federal Privacy Act of 1974 requires us to inform you that providing us with your Social Security number is mandatory. Ohio Revised Code sections 5703.05, 5703.057 and 5747.08 authorize us to request this information. We need your Social Security number in order to administer this tax.
